Output 31500c3e2bb76009d4fcab4ea1ffbc26e3e11cd84de844ddffef21696aa2e23a:0

value
154461
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2efbdb9e5dbc810952ff75d09b671d5dc1ec7489 OP_EQUALVERIFY OP_CHECKSIG
address
15HRoDaUzMfQCRp11xB3ax71fiVDPegcCD
transaction
31500c3e2bb76009d4fcab4ea1ffbc26e3e11cd84de844ddffef21696aa2e23a
confirmations
32760
spent
true